Description
This COB LED strip puts out a continuous, dot-free line of light along a flexible 5m reel, drawing up to 14.4W per metre for around 2110 lumens per metre in a crisp 4000K cool white. Unlike spaced SMD reels, the chip-on-board format gives an even, solid run of brightness with no visible diodes, so the lit edge reads as one smooth line rather than a row of points. American buyers will know this style as cool white led tape light, and the same reel suits under cabinet runs or cove detailing. With a high CRI of Ra90, colours and surfaces under the strip stay true.
The reel is cut-to-length at the marked interval every 4.55cm, so a run can be trimmed to fit a shelf, plinth, stair edge or display cabinet without waste. It works well for under-cabinet task light in a kitchen, accent lighting along coving, or backlighting a media unit or shelving, where the dot-free output reads cleanly off a reflective surface. Because the light is a linear strip rather than ambient room lighting, plan it as an outline or wash along the length you want lit rather than to cover a floor area. The 30,000 hour rated life keeps replacement intervals long across these everyday locations.
The strip runs on 24V DC, so it needs a matching 24V LED driver sized to the total wattage of the length used, supplied separately. It is not a mains-direct product and should not be wired straight into a wall socket. Rated IP00, it is for dry indoor use only and must be kept clear of bathrooms, damp areas and any outdoor location. Self-adhesive backing fixes it to a clean, dry surface, and at 24V over a 5m reel the run stays even end to end. Frequently Asked
Does this strip need a separate driver?
Yes. It runs on 24V DC, not mains voltage, so it needs a 24V LED driver rated for the total wattage of the length you use. The driver is sold separately, so size it to your run before ordering.
Where can the strip be cut?
The reel can be trimmed to length at the marked cut points, which fall every 4.55cm along the strip. Always cut on the marked line so each section keeps a complete circuit, and only cut the strip when it is disconnected from power.
Can it be used outdoors or in a bathroom?
No. This strip is rated IP00, which means dry indoor use only. Keep it out of bathrooms, kitchens splash zones, damp areas and any outdoor location, and choose a coated IP65 strip for those settings instead.
What does the dot-free COB format give you?
COB places diodes in a continuous chip-on-board line rather than spaced points, so the lit run reads as one smooth band with no visible dots. With Ra90 colour rendering and 2110 lumens per metre, it gives an even, true-to-colour wash that suits under-cabinet and cove lighting.
